When selling options to grow a portfolio you rely on banking that weekly/monthly premium.
However, there will be times when the option you sold becomes ITM. What does the option seller do? Ah...yes, roll the option for a credit!
Having sold options for 3 years now, I made many mistakes rolling options from choosing the wrong strike and expiration. I truly believe that rolling options is a true skill and more important to understand than your initial strike price section.
To test my skill - I placed an ITM put on Coinbase (on purpose) and documented my rolling journey of managing the position and exiting for a profit. I chose Coinbase as it's a volatile stock.
